GamingVoice has written up their 4.5/5 star, praising review of Knights of the Old Republic, though they fault a number of things like the minigames and this:


Another problem -- that was most likely induced by a console's lack of keyboard -- is that items could not be renamed. KOTOR allows certain weapons and armor to be upgraded along the way. While most of the upgradeable blasters and swords have distinct names, the lightsabers are just called "lightsaber" or "double-blade lightsaber". Trust me, you will collect MANY of these along the way. So after you spend a lot of time upgrading your lightsaber with new features -- it'd be a shame to accidentally sell it because you had 10 similar ones on hand.​

Or datapad. I had tons of those, and you can't sell them. I hate datapads.
